List 共 5 篇文章

C++ STL容器的选择:vector、list、deque各自的优势场景
2026-05-17 06:12:23
C++ STL容器的选择:vector、list、deque各自的优势场景 编写高效C++程序的核心在于选对数据结构。标准模板库(STL)提供了序列容器 vector、list 和 deque,它们各有千秋。盲目使用不仅会导致性能下降,还会增加内存消耗。以下指南将帮助你根据具体场景做出最优选择。 1
C++ STL 容器
27 0
Python collections.deque与list在队列操作中的性能对比
2026-04-26 18:14:46
Python collections.deque与list在队列操作中的性能对比 在Python中,处理数据序列时,list 是最常用的数据结构。然而,当涉及到队列操作——即先进先出(FIFO)的场景时,内置的 list 往往不是最佳选择。Python 标准库中的 collections.deque
Python collections.deque list
64 0
C++ STL 容器:vector、list、map 的使用
2026-04-18 19:24:25
C++ STL 容器:vector、list、map 的使用 C++ 标准模板库(STL)提供了三种最核心的容器:vector(动态数组)、list(双向链表)和 map(映射)。掌握它们的使用是编写高效 C++ 代码的基础。以下指南将直接展示如何在代码中应用它们,涵盖定义、增删改查及适用场景。 1
C++ STL 容器
57 0
Dart 集合操作:List、Set、Map 的使用
2026-04-02 19:33:26
Dart 集合操作:List、Set、Map 的使用 Dart 提供了三种核心集合类型:List(有序列表)、Set(无重复元素集合)和 Map(键值对映射)。掌握它们的创建、读取、修改和查询方法,是高效编写 Dart 程序的基础。 List:有序可重复的序列 创建 List dart // 创建空
Dart List Set
51 0
Scheme 数据结构:list、vector、hash-table
2026-04-02 17:44:33
Scheme 数据结构:list、vector、hashtable Scheme 提供三种核心内置数据结构:list(列表)、vector(向量)和 hashtable(哈希表)。它们在内存布局、访问速度和使用场景上有显著区别。掌握它们的创建、读取、修改和查询方法,是高效编写 Scheme 程序的基
Scheme 数据结构 list
59 0